实验步骤: 第一步:在R1 、 R2 、 R3上的预配置 r1(config)#int e0/0 r1(config-if)#ip add 172.16.1.1 255.255.255.0< BR> r1(config-if)#no sh r1(config)#ip route 0.0.0.0 0.0.0.0 172.16.1.2配置静态路由 r1(config)#^Z r2(config)#int e0/0 r2(config-if)#ip add 172.16.1.2 255.255.255.0 r2(config-if)#no sh r2(config-if)#int e2/0 r2(config-if)#ip add 192.168.1.2 255.255.255.0 r2(config-if)#no sh r3(config)#int e2/0 r3(config-if)#ip add 192.168.1.3 255.255.255.0 r3(config-if)#no sh r3(config)#ip route 0.0.0.0 0.0.0.0 192.168.1.2 配置静态路由 r3(config)#^Z r3(config)#li vty 0 4 r3(config-line)#pass r3(config-line)#password cisco r3(config-line)#exit第二步: 在R2上配置zhang r2#conf t Enter configuration commands, one per line. End with CNTL/Z. r2(config)#ip inspect name zhang tcp 检查TCP r2(config)#ip inspect name zhang udp 检查udp r2(config)#ip inspect udp idle-time 60 检查udp 的时间是60S r2(config)#ip inspect name zhang icmp timeout 5 超时时间是5S r2(config)#ip inspect name zhang http alert off 控制HTTP r2(config)# r2(config)#int e0/0 r2(config-if)#ip inspect zhang in 在e0/0接口检查流量是否满足以上所定义过的任何一条 r2(config-if)#exit r2(config)#acce 100 deny ip any any log 做ACL拒绝IP的任何包通过 r2(config)#int e2/0 r2(config-if)#ip acce 100 in 将ACL要用到e2/0的进接口上 第三步: 从R1上TELNET R3 r1#telnet 192.168.1.3 Trying 192.168.1.3 … Open User Access Verification Password: r3> 从R3上TELNET R1 r3#telnet 172.16.1.1 Trying 172.16.1.1 … % Destination unreachable; gateway or host down 第四步: 从R1上ping R2直连接口 r1#ping 172.16.1.2 Type escape sequence to abort. Sending 5, 100-byte ICMP Echos to 172.16.1.2, timeout is 2 seconds: !!!!! Success rate is 100 percent (5/5), round-trip min/avg/max = 28/54/92 ms 从R2上ping R1直连接口 r2#ping 172.16.1.1 Type escape sequence to abort. Sending 5, 100-byte ICMP Echos to 172.16.1.1, timeout is 2 seconds: !!!!! Success rate is 100 percent (5/5), round-trip min/avg/max = 16/67/124 ms 从R2ping R3直连接口 r2#ping *Mar 1 00:15:20.615: %SYS-5-CONFIG_I: Configured from console by console r2#ping 192.168.1.3 Type escape sequence to abort. Sending 5, 100-byte ICMP Echos to 192.168.1.3, timeout is 2 seconds: *Mar 1 00:15:28.055: %SEC-6-IPACCESSLOGDP: list 100 denied icmp 192.168.1.3 -> 192.168.1.2 (0/0), 1 packet….. //说明icmp包可以到达,但 是没有回包 Success rate is 0 percent (0/5) 从R3ing R2连接口r3#ping 192.168.1.2 Type escape sequence to abort. Sending 5, 100-byte ICMP Echos to 192.168.1.2, timeout is 2 seconds: U.U.U //说明icmp包不可以到达目的地 Success rate is 0 percent (0/5) r1#ping 192.168.1.3 Type escape sequence to abort. Sending 5, 100-byte ICMP Echos to 192.168.1.3, timeout is 2 seconds: !!!!! Success rate is 100 percent (5/5), round-trip min/avg/max = 76/124/156 ms r2#debug ip inspect icmp INSPECT ICMP Inspection debugging is on r2# *Mar 1 00:35:09.187: CBAC: ICMP Echo pkt 172.16.1.1 => 192.168.1.3 *Mar 1 00:35:09.187: CBAC: ICMP Echo pkt 172.16.1.1 => 192.168.1.3 *Mar 1 00:35:09.191: CBAC: ICMP Echo pkt 172.16.1.1 => 192.168.1.3 *Mar 1 00:35:09.263: CBAC: ICMP Echo Reply pkt 192.168.1.3 => 172.16.1.1 *Mar 1 00:35:09.375: CBAC: ICMP Echo pkt 172.16.1.1 => 192.168.1.3 *Mar 1 00:35:09.423: CBAC: ICMP Echo Reply pkt 192.168.1.3 => 172.16.1.1 *Mar 1 00:35:09.467: CBAC: ICMP Echo pkt 172.16.1.1 => 192.168.1.3 *Mar 1 00:35:09.531: CBAC: ICMP Echo Reply pkt 192.168.1.3 => 172.16.1.1 *Mar 1 00:35:09.563: CBAC: ICMP Echo pkt 172.16.1.1 => 192.168.1.3 r2# *Mar 1 00:35:09.623: CBAC: ICMP Echo Reply pkt 192.168.1.3 => 172.16.1.1 *Mar 1 00:35:09.671: CBAC: ICMP Echo pkt 172.16.1.1 => 192.168.1.3 *Mar 1 00:35:09.735: CBAC: ICMP Echo Reply pkt 192.168.1.3 => 172.16.1.1
